com.veriplace.client.store
Class MemoryUserTokenStore

java.lang.Object
  extended by com.veriplace.client.store.MemoryUserTokenStore
All Implemented Interfaces:
UserTokenStore

public class MemoryUserTokenStore
extends java.lang.Object
implements UserTokenStore

An in-memory implemention of UserTokenStore


Constructor Summary
MemoryUserTokenStore()
           
 
Method Summary
 Token get(User user)
          Retrieve a token by user.
 void put(User user, Token token)
          Save a token for a user.
 void remove(User user)
          Remove a token for a user.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

MemoryUserTokenStore

public MemoryUserTokenStore()
Method Detail

get

public Token get(User user)
Retrieve a token by user.

Specified by:
get in interface UserTokenStore

put

public void put(User user,
                Token token)
Save a token for a user.

Specified by:
put in interface UserTokenStore

remove

public void remove(User user)
Remove a token for a user.

Specified by:
remove in interface UserTokenStore